If f(x) is the number of primes less than or equal to x, find the value
of f(90) - f(80) = ?
(a) 3 (b) 2
(c) 1 (d) 4
Number Theory
Solution:
f(90) - f(80) = Number of primer between 90 and 80.
Listing, we have 83 and 89.
f(90) - f(80) = 2
Answer Choice (B)
